Chapin's Free-tailed Bat vs Malagasy White-bellied Free-tailed Bat

Chaerephon chapini compared with Mops leucostigma

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Chapin's Free-tailed Bat Malagasy White-bellied Free-tailed Bat
Kingdom same Animalia (hayvan) Animalia (hayvan)
Phylum same Chordata (Kordalılar) Chordata (Kordalılar)
Class same Mammalia (memeliler) Mammalia (memeliler)
Order same Chiroptera (yarasa) Chiroptera (yarasa)
Family same Molossidae Molossidae
Genus Chaerephon Mops
Species Chaerephon chapini Mops leucostigma

Evolutionary Relationship

Chapin's Free-tailed Bat and Malagasy White-bellied Free-tailed Bat share a common ancestor at the Family level: Molossidae.
